Come eseguire la stessa macro su più fogli di lavoro contemporaneamente in Excel?
Normalmente, possiamo eseguire una macro in un foglio di lavoro, se ci sono più fogli che devono applicare la stessa macro, dovresti attivare il codice uno per un foglio. Se esiste un altro modo rapido per eseguire la stessa macro su più fogli di lavoro contemporaneamente in Excel?
Esegui o esegui la stessa macro su più fogli di lavoro contemporaneamente con il codice VBA
Esegui o esegui la stessa macro su più fogli di lavoro contemporaneamente con il codice VBA
Per eseguire una macro su più fogli contemporaneamente senza attivarla uno per uno, puoi applicare il seguente codice VBA, per favore fai come segue:
1. Tieni premuto il ALT + F11 chiavi per aprire il Microsoft Visual Basic, Applications Edition finestra.
2. Clic inserire > Modulie incolla la seguente macro nel file Moduli Finestra.
Codice VBA: esegui la stessa macro su più fogli di lavoro contemporaneamente:
Sub Dosomething()
Dim xSh As Worksheet
Application.ScreenUpdating = False
For Each xSh In Worksheets
xSh.Select
Call RunCode
Next
Application.ScreenUpdating = True
End Sub
Sub RunCode()
'your code here
End Sub
Note:: Nel codice sopra, copia e incolla il tuo codice senza l'estensione Sub intestazione e End Sub piè di pagina tra il Sub Runcode () ed End Sub script. Vedi screenshot:
3. Quindi posizionare il cursore sulla prima parte della macro e premere F5 chiave per eseguire il codice e il codice macro verrà applicato a uno per uno foglio.
Rimuovi tutte le macro da più cartelle di lavoro:
Kutools for Excel's Rimuovi tutte le macro in batch l'utilità può aiutarti a rimuovere tutte le macro da più cartelle di lavoro di cui hai bisogno. Scarica e prova gratuitamente Kutools per Excel adesso! Kutools for Excel: con più di 300 utili componenti aggiuntivi di Excel, liberi di provare senza limitazioni in 30 giorni. Scarica e prova gratuita ora! |
I migliori strumenti per la produttività in ufficio
Potenzia le tue competenze di Excel con Kutools per Excel e sperimenta l'efficienza come mai prima d'ora. Kutools per Excel offre oltre 300 funzionalità avanzate per aumentare la produttività e risparmiare tempo. Fai clic qui per ottenere la funzionalità di cui hai più bisogno...
Office Tab porta l'interfaccia a schede in Office e semplifica notevolmente il tuo lavoro
- Abilita la modifica e la lettura a schede in Word, Excel, PowerPoint, Publisher, Access, Visio e Project.
- Apri e crea più documenti in nuove schede della stessa finestra, piuttosto che in nuove finestre.
- Aumenta la produttività del 50% e riduce ogni giorno centinaia di clic del mouse!